Transaction af93d263f15a65d1ab35b758c81a783df136dde28b084ead5731963ee3f77209
1 Input
2 Outputs
- af93d263f15a65d1ab35b758c81a783df136dde28b084ead5731963ee3f77209:0
- af93d263f15a65d1ab35b758c81a783df136dde28b084ead5731963ee3f77209:1
value 3352933
address 17LiTMuWsZvAMFzTX2DpdqjkjQV3i8SXsg
value 2587067
address 13NLvVnSbN2tuisvSv9NSXF1iRWMwELTxC